The implementation of stress management strategies in schools
Abstract
The focus of this paper is to investigate the possibility of creating an action plan for the
implementation of stress management strategies in schools. The specific objectives are to describe the essence and
nature of stress management in schools and to outline the features of an action plan for strategic management in
schools. The authors used an evaluative and integrative literature review to investigate information that pertains
to related concepts such as strategy formulation in education, the elements of strategies in education and imperatives
of stress management in education. This paper’s findings point towards the necessity of introducing stress
management strategies in schools. It is recommended that the Department and its officials accept responsibility
for managing strategic issues proactively and reactively. At the same time a framework of structures and processes
through which individuals can be engaged in conversations and dialogues about the strategic direction of the school,
must be generated.
